Psychiatric Assessment Online

Online psychiatric tests can help you understand the root cause of your symptoms. These tools can provide you with a diagnostic and a treatment plan. They are not a substitute for a visit with a therapist or psychiatrist.

Doctor on Demand is a telehealth platform that gives appointment times on weekends and evenings with 24/7 access to communication and a variety of providers. Doctor on Demand does not provide prescriptions for controlled substances, which require an in-person visit.

Cost

The cost of a psychiatric assessment online can be wildly different. It depends on the psychologist and the office they work for and the amount of sessions required to finish the evaluation. In general the more time you spend with a psychiatrist and the longer your session, the higher the cost. It is also contingent on whether additional services are required, such as medication or therapy.

The majority of health insurance plans cover mental health care however some do not include the service in their coverage or require a referral from your primary doctor (PCP). Some psychiatrists charge a flat fee for a full psychological evaluation or evaluation, while others provide a sliding scale. If you don't have insurance you have other options, such as government programs and community-based organizations.

Convenience

Online psychiatric assessments are an option for those who require assistance but don't have the time to travel. They can save patients money by reducing travel costs and can also lessen the stress that comes waiting in the office of a doctor.

These services typically allow individuals to connect with psychiatrists over the Internet and may be covered by health insurance. However, it is important to keep in mind that a telepsychiatrist is not the same as a psychologist or counselor. Psychologists and counselors are able perform psychological assessments but they cannot prescribe medication. Psychiatrists on the other hand, can diagnose mental health issues and prescribe medications to treat them.

Many telepsychiatry services provide a range of diagnostic tools, including screening questionnaires. They can be utilized in conjunction with a psychotherapy interview to help a psychologist make the cause of. These tests can be accessed via the Web and are a simple method of assessing a patient's mood. These tools can also help determine the root cause of certain problems.

The Telehealth service Doctor on Demand offers online psychotherapy assessments by licensed professionals, including psychiatrists and therapists. The simple registration process puts the control in the hands of the users, who can select their preferred providers and schedule sessions at their convenience. It also works with various insurance plans, including Medicare and Medicaid.

Reliability

Psychiatric assessment online what is a psychiatric assessment an effective method to assist those suffering from a variety mental health problems. However it is essential to remember that these tests are not meant to replace face-to-face evaluations. While they can be useful but it is crucial to have a therapist oversee these assessments so that patients receive the best possible treatment. A therapist can evaluate the severity of a problem and recommend the best treatment during a face-toface evaluation. This may reduce symptoms and improve the quality of life.

A recent study published in the World Journal of Psychiatry found that people who used an online assessment of mental health experienced higher levels of well-being than those who did not take the test. In addition, people who took the test were more likely to seek help from a professional and received a more precise diagnosis. These findings must be confirmed by more clinical trials to be considered reliable.

Many online mental health tests use diagnostic tools that have been validated clinically. Certain assessments, for instance include questions from the Patient's Health Questionnaire-9 (PHQ-9) which is a depression screening tool commonly used in psychiatry. Certain assessments contain questions in response to the patient's symptoms or behavior and others test the social and personality traits of the patient. These tools can be more reliable than self-assessments and quizzes that turn disorders into a label or personality trait that can stigmatize the conditions they are meant to diagnose.

In the Delta Study participants completed an online test for mood and psychiatric disorders that was scored based on an algorithm that used DSM-5 logic. Participants also completed a nondiagnostic report that indicated their most likely mood disorders and any comorbid conditions, as well as a customized psychoeducation. The report also provided information on how to seek help, such as an inventory of mental health-related applications and resources.
